Synopsis

Most DOT violations do not happen because drivers do not care. They happen because small problems get missed.

A light goes unchecked. A tire issue is ignored. A document is buried. A warning sign is brushed off. A rushed pre-trip turns into a roadside problem.

DOT Violations Most Drivers Miss is a practical guide for commercial drivers who want to sharpen their awareness, protect their record, and avoid the hidden trouble spots that often lead to costly violations, delays, and unnecessary stress.
This book helps drivers understand how small details can become big problems when they are overlooked. It covers common trouble areas such as tires, lights, brakes, air systems, leaks, loose parts, paperwork, trailer issues, cab organization, rushing, assumptions, and weak daily habits.
Inside, readers will learn how to:

  • recognize common DOT violation trouble spots before they become bigger issues
  • spot warning signs during pre-trip and daily inspections
  • avoid rushed inspection mistakes and careless assumptions
  • improve paperwork, trailer, and cab organization
  • understand how small details affect safety, reputation, and inspection readiness
  • build a daily violation-prevention routine
  • respond properly when problems are found
